On 29 May 1985, before the European cup final between Juventus and Liverpool's, a large group of Reds' supporters breached a fence separating them from Juventus fans. 39 people died and 600 were injured, yet the game was played despite the disaster in order to prevent further violence, with Juventus winning 1-0. Former RAI commentator Bruno Pizzul called the game and recalled that night for us.
